The Death of Traditional SEO: How AI Search is Rewriting the Rules of Web Development in 2026

If you are still optimizing your business website purely for traditional search engines, you are already falling behind. In 2026, the landscape of search has fundamentally shifted. AI Search—driven by Google’s Search Generative Experience (SGE), ChatGPT, and Perplexity—is no longer just a trend; it is the new standard for how users find information, products, and services.

But what does this mean for your web presence? The death of traditional SEO doesn’t mean search is dead. It means the rules of web development have been completely rewritten. To survive and thrive in this new era, your website’s architecture, content strategy, and technical foundation must evolve.

Why Traditional SEO is Losing Its Power

For years, the SEO playbook was predictable: target a keyword, write a 2,000-word blog post, build backlinks, and wait for the traffic to roll in. Today, AI-driven search engines answer the user’s question directly on the results page. There is no need to click through a recipe blog to find the ingredients, or scroll past 10 paragraphs of fluff to get a pricing estimate.

This “zero-click” phenomenon means that if your site is built just to capture traditional clicks, your traffic will plummet. AI search engines are looking for entities, authoritative answers, and structured data, not just keyword density.

How AI Search Changes Web Development in 2026

To capture visibility in AI search, web development must shift from “building pages” to “building knowledge graphs.” Here is how the technical requirements have changed:

  • Semantic HTML and Structured Data: AI crawlers rely heavily on Schema markup (JSON-LD). Every product, service, and article must be explicitly defined. If an AI can’t parse your site’s structure instantly, it won’t use your data in its generated answers.
  • Extreme Performance Metrics: AI models prioritize sites that load instantaneously. Core Web Vitals are more critical than ever. Slow sites are bypassed by AI crawlers trying to assemble real-time answers.
  • API-First Architecture: Modern AI tools increasingly consume data via APIs. An API-first headless architecture ensures your content can be read seamlessly by machine learning models and conversational agents.

The Rise of “AIO” (Artificial Intelligence Optimization)

The new frontier is AIO—optimizing for Artificial Intelligence. This means ensuring your brand is recognized as an authoritative entity by Large Language Models (LLMs). When a user asks ChatGPT, “Who are the best custom software developers in my area?”, the AI isn’t checking a live index of keywords; it’s retrieving weighted relationships from its training data and real-time structured searches.

Your website must act as the ultimate source of truth for your brand, providing clear, machine-readable facts, case studies, and unique insights that AI models want to cite as references.
